Sales leads,

We will retire the Ambervale product line at the end of next quarter. Orders close on the last day of the quarter; support continues for twelve months. Migration paths to the Ketterway suite are documented and discounts are authorized for affected accounts up to 15%.

Expect questions from long-standing customers in the Norwick territory; escalate exceptions to regional managers. Quota adjustments will follow in the next planning cycle.

The confidential note on what replaces Ambervale follows below.

internal memo for kawip-hadug: Headcount on the Wenwyn team goes from 7 to 140 by the end of January. Gross margin on Wenwyn came in at 20 percent against a plan of 15 percent.

# Break-Glass: Catalog Cache Invalidation

Scope: the Pinrow product catalog at Veldstone Retail. If stale prices persist after a purge and the Hollowmere invalidation queue is wedged, use break-glass to flush the edge tier directly. Contractors: get verbal sign-off from the catalog lead first. Steps: open the Hollowmere admin shell, select emergency-flush, confirm the tenant, and run it once — repeated flushes thrash the origin. Access is logged and expires after 20 minutes. Unseal the admin shell with the passphrase below.

recovery phrase for kahop-tajog: istix-casvan

**CI note: timezone weirdness in report exports**

Heads up, support folks — if a customer says their Ledgerpine export shows times shifted by a few hours, it's probably the CI image. The export workers got rebuilt last week and the base image defaults to UTC, while older workers used the account's locale. Fix is rolling out; meanwhile tell customers the data itself is fine, just the display offset. Affected exports carry the build token shown below.

build token for bajof-tahop: htk4_a981

# Build Provenance: Frostline Archiver

Hey team — quick explainer on how we trace archive runs. Every time the Frostline Archiver seals a cold storage bucket, it stamps the manifest with the exact builder image and commit that produced the binary. That way, if someone asks "which version archived my bucket in March?", you can answer without guessing. Don't trust a manifest that's missing its stamp; escalate it instead. For reference, the current production token is shown just below.

build token for kahif-kajof: htk4_c609